What Are Fortnite Moments?

When you dive into *Fortnite* after the latest update, you'll notice a host of new features including Quests, items in the Item Shop, and a fresh Battle Pass. Amidst these, a subtle yet impactful feature called Moments awaits your discovery. Moments allow you to set the mood of your match by selecting background music that plays as you leap from the Battle Bus and celebrate your Victory Royale. It's a fantastic touch from Epic Games, giving you the freedom to curate your gaming soundtrack from your collection of Jam Tracks.

How To Use Fortnite Moments

Jam Tracks as part of an article about Fortnite Moments.To infuse your Battle Royale gameplay with your personal soundtrack, navigate to the Locker tab in the main menu and scroll to the Moments section. You'll find two options: Intro Music for setting the tone as you descend from the Battle Bus, and Celebration Music to triumphantly mark your Victory Royale. Selecting these options will open up your library of Jam Tracks, allowing you to pick the perfect songs to energize your entry and celebrate your win.

How To Get Fortnite Moments

If the current selection in your library doesn't suit your taste, you can expand your collection by visiting the Item Shop and exploring the "Take Your Stage" section. With over 300 Jam Tracks available, featuring artists like Metallica, Bad Bunny, Lil Nas X, and Kendrick Lamar, you're spoiled for choice. Each track costs 500 V-Bucks, approximately $4.50, but the thrill of hearing your chosen tunes during gameplay is well worth it. For a more comprehensive package, consider the Music Pass, which includes multiple Jam Tracks, instruments, and accessories. The current Icon is Hatsune Miku, with contributions from artists like Jennifer Lopez and CAKE. If you prefer not to spend money, you can always enjoy the in-game radio, though it won't be as personalized.
